That's exactly right.  Also, I believe that that PayPal Sandbox doesn't call
back properly to Satchmo stores in any case.  At least it didn't the last
time I was testing.

What I often do is to set up a special product test on a live or beta
server.  I make a product that costs $.01, and turn off PP sandbox mode.  I
then can test everything, not spending much at all, but still conclusively
validating that the PayPal callback does work and the order gets marked
"New".

> Is your satchmo shop running on localhost?
>
> When you place an order using paypal, the site directs you to paypal, and
> you make a payment (whether its sandbox or not this still applies).  When
> paypal processes your order, it needs to contact your satchmo site to tell
> it the payment has been processed.  If your satchmo shop is running on
> localhost, Paypal has no way of contacting your shop to tell it a payment
> was processed.
